WWW.UPANDCOMINGWEEKLY.COM SEPTEMBER 12-18, 2018 UCW 7 Silent Sam A message from UNC System Board of Governors member Thom Goolsby: Silent Sam Toppling, the fix was in TO THE EDITOR As law enforcement officers were order to stand-down, outside criminal radicals draped the monument with curtains. Over the course of 1 1/2 hours, criminals when to work on the statue with a blow torch and tools to detach it from its pedestal. With the monument covered and no law enforcement effort to stop the radicals, a tow rope was attached and the monument was toppled from its pedestal. e next day, Chapel Hill Police Chief Chris Blue emailed his officers and thanked them for their efforts. So far, UNC-Chapel Hill has NOT produced emails and text messages from UNC Campus Law Enforce- ment and the Administration. All media requests for information MUST be honored under North Caro- lina's Open Records Law WITHOUT delay. More to come! We will not rest until justice is served. All who committed these acts of violence and property destruction or were complicit in the illegal activities WILL be held accountable. e monument will be reinstalled within 90 days from the date it was toppled under North Carolina General Statue Section 100-2.1).
